What is 2011-2012 low income verification

The 2011-2012 Low Income Verification Form is an education document used by dependent students and their parents to report low income for federal student aid purposes.

To complete the 2011-2012 Low Income Verification Form, you must be a dependent student or the parent of a dependent student applying for federal student aid in Arizona.
While specific deadlines may vary, it’s essential to submit the 2011-2012 Low Income Verification Form promptly to meet financial aid application deadlines for the 2011-2012 academic year.
Completed forms can be submitted to the NPC Financial Aid Office in Arizona, either through electronic submission via pdfFiller or by mail, depending on your preference.
You will typically need to provide income reports, expense records, and documentation of any benefits received during 2010 along with the Low Income Verification Form.
Ensure that all entries are accurate, and double-check for any omitted fields. Avoid using outdated income information, and make sure both student and parent signatures are present.
Processing times for the 2011-2012 Low Income Verification Form can vary depending on the financial aid office's workload. It’s recommended to check with the office for their specific timelines.
